The average cost of senior living in Burton is 2,864 per month. Cheaper nearby regions include Taylor, AZ with an average of 2,796 per month.

The cost of memory care facilities in Burton, Arizona ranges from $2,270 to $3,608. The average Memory Care cost in Burton, Arizona is 2,864. Prices often vary based on care provided, amenities, unit size, and more.
